WebGraph theory is a deceptively simple area of mathematics: it provides interesting problems that can be easily understood, yet it allows for incredible application to things as diverse as the efficient storage of chemicals, optimal assignments, distribution networks, and better … WebNov 18, 2024 · The Basics of Graph Theory. 2.1. The Definition of a Graph. A graph is a structure that comprises a set of vertices and a set of edges. So in order to have a graph we need to define the elements of two sets: vertices and edges. The vertices are the elementary units that a graph must have, in order for it to exist. WebThe following elements are fundamental to understanding graph theory: Graph. WebOct 31, 2024 · Figure 5.1. 1: A simple graph. A graph G = ( V, E) that is not simple can be represented by using multisets: a loop is a multiset { v, v } = { 2 ⋅ v } and multiple edges are represented by making E a multiset.
